An investigation has been opened into seawater pollution in Bodrum, Turkey
The Turkish authorities opened an investigation into seawater pollution in the city of Bodrum, after monitoring indicators of deteriorating water quality in the famous coastal area, as part of efforts to protect the marine environment and preserve tourist destinations.

Laboratory tests are continuing to determine the source of the potential pollution and the necessary measures to address the situation and protect the marine ecosystem in the area.
